On Thu, Jun 09, 2022 at 10:33:40PM +0200, Christophe JAILLET wrote:
> The 'max' parameter of ida_alloc_max() and ida_alloc_range() is not
> interpreted as it was in the deprecated ida_simple_get().
>
> The 'max' value in the new functions is inclusive but it was exclusive
> before. So, in older code, this parameter was often a power of 2, such as
> 1 << 16, so that the maximum possible value was 0xffff.
>
> Now a power of 2 value is spurious.
